Potrebujem exportovať sériu 5000 dokumentov Excel do MySQL. Problém je, že súbory programu Excel boli opakovane zlúčené. (Pozri odkaz na snímku obrazovky: http://cgtest.forakergroup.com/images/excel.png )
A1 CHARITY NUM AMT
+ A2 name 1 $100
| + A3 2 $105
| | A4 2 $105
| L A5 5 $105
L A6 5 $105
+ A7 name2 1 $100
| + A8 2 $105
| | A9 2 $105
| L A10 5 $105
L A11 5 $105
Potrebujem vložiť charitatívny názov (v súčasnosti v A2) do každého z nasledujúcich stĺpcov, kde bol zlúčený (A3, A4 atď.).
Existuje nejaká funkcia v programe Excel, ktorá opätovne obnoví zlúčené bunky?
odpovede:
1 pre odpoveď č. 1Ak požadujete to, čo si myslím, že ste potom funkcia nie je potrebná (ani kód). Stačí vybrať príslušný stĺpec Domov> Úprava - Nájsť & Vybrať, Bloky, kľúč =
, hore, ctrl+vstúpiť.
0 pre odpoveď č. 2
Nasledujúce makro vyplní všetky medzery, ak sú všetky bunky nezmazané.
Sub Fill_Empty()
Dim oRng As Range
Set oRng = Selection
Selection.Font.Bold = True
Selection.SpecialCells(xlCellTypeBlanks).Select
Selection.Font.Bold = False
Selection.FormulaR1C1 = "=R[-1]C"
oRng.Copy
oRng.PasteSpecial Paste:=xlValues, Operation:=xlNone, _
SkipBlanks:=False, Transpose:=False
End Sub
Vďaka Levasseurovi za návrh na napísanie makra.